Product Description:
The eradication of polio ranks high on the list of American achievements. Thanks to the dedication of Jonas Salk and his team of advocates, what was once a terrifying public health crisis is now a relic and a testament to the power of science. This entry in the AMERICAN EXPERIENCE series looks back at the 1950s--when the disease was ravaging young lives--and chronicles Salk’s quest to create a vaccine. THE POLIO CRUSADE features intimate interviews with survivors as well as a scientist who aided Salk in his research.
Description by PBS Video:
Based in part on David Oshinsky's Pulitzer Prize-winning book, Polio: An American Story, this one-hour film chronicles a decades-long crusade, fueled by the bold leadership of a single philanthropy and its innovative public relations campaign, and features a bitter battle between two scientists and the breakthrough of a forgotten woman researcher.
